How much water do I use for 2 cups of rice?

Water is added to rice to soften it and make it cooked evenly. The amount of water to be added to rice varies with the variety of rice. Generally, 1.5 cups of water is added to 1 cup of white rice. For brown rice, 2 cups of water is added to 1 cup of rice. 

To cook 2 cups of white rice, 3 cups of water is needed. To cook 2 cups of brown rice, 4 cups of water is needed.

How much water do I add to 1 cup of rice in a rice cooker?

Adding the correct amount of water is important for making perfect rice in a rice cooker. Most rice cookers come with a measuring cup that is specifically designed for this task. If you are using a different measuring cup, make sure to use the proper conversion ratio.

For every cup of dry rice, you will need to add 1 and 1/2 cups of water. This will produce perfectly cooked rice that is fluffy and tender. If you are looking for a softer or firmer texture, you can adjust the water ratio accordingly.

If you are making a larger batch of rice, you can simply multiply the amount of water by the number of cups of rice you are cooking. For instance, if you are cooking 3 cups of rice, you will need to add 4 and 1/2 cups of water.

If you are unsure about how much water to add, it is always best to start with less and add more as needed. This will help prevent overcooked or mushy rice.
